YoungBoy Never Broke Again Announces 2025 MASA Tour: See the Dates

YoungBoy Never Broke Again is getting back on the road once again. YB announced the 2025 MASA Tour (Make America Slime Again) on Thursday (May 15) as the Baton Rouge native regained his freedom after being released from federal prison in March.
The MASA Tour is slated to be YoungBoy’s first-ever headlining trek and he’s bringing DeeBaby, EBK Jaaybo and K3 on the road with him as special guests.
The 27-city U.S. tour kicks off on Sept. 2 in Dallas and will rumble through Houston, Los Angeles, Oakland, Phoenix, Denver, Chicago, Brooklyn, Boston, Philly, Detroit, Orlando, Miami and Atlanta, and will wrap up with a Louisiana show in New Orleans on Oct. 19.
Artist pre-sale slots are open through Sunday (May 18) night, and the general public will have their shot to purchase tickets on Thursday (May 22) at 10 a.m. local time. Various VIP packages are going to be available as well.
YoungBoy returned with his More Leaks project, filled with 20 solo tracks, in March ahead of his release from prison. He’s continued to appease his fans’ appetites with “Shot Callin” earlier in May.
YB — born Kentrell Gaulden — pleaded guilty to a pair of federal gun charges in 2024. One case stemmed from a possession of firearms arrest in Louisiana, while a second was over a gun found when he was arrested in Utah.
YoungBoy was sentenced to 23 months in prison and five years of probation on those convictions in December. He was slated to be released in July due to time served, but he secured a supervised release months earlier in late March.
